For the first book review of 2020, the MasterMinds are discussing "Crushing It!" by Gary Vaynerchuk. The MasterMind duo are joined by social influencer, Henry Goss. During the episode, the three discuss how to monetize and brand a business. Chris explains the issue he has with sharing too much on social media. Henry shares with Chris and Malia the benefits of staying consistent with pushing out content. Malia discusses how collaborations can help businesses and influencers grow their brands.
